**Amy Chelsea, once stolen from her family, returns after six years—but the secrets she carries threaten to unravel a bittersweet homecoming.

“An intelligent, tense psychological drama.”—Kirkus Reviews

“Though grim, this tearjerker has a thankfully hopeful resolution.”—Booklist**

Amy and her cousin Dee have been missing for six long years. Then one day, Amy steps off a bus and back into her old life—without Dee. Now sixteen years old, Amy won’t talk about where she’s been, what’s happened to her, or even what’s become of Dee. Afraid of what may happen next, Amy stays silent, desperate to protect her secrets at any cost.

As Amy tries to readjust to being “home,” she finds she’s returned to a life she barely recognizes. The strain of the last six years has left Amy’s family beyond broken, and the guilt that she’s come back without Dee feels insurmountable. Amy soon makes the painful realization that the secrets she’s keeping may end up hurting those she loves the most. She decides she has to go back to move forward, risking everything along the way—maybe even her own life.
